#918259 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#918259 is composed of 56.9% red, 51% green and 34.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 10.3% magenta, 38.6% yellow and 43.1% black. It has a hue angle of 43.9 degrees, a saturation of 23.9% and a lightness of 45.9%. #918259 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ffb2 with #230500. Closest websafe color is: #999966.

Shades and Tints of #918259
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0a07 is the darkest color, while #fefef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#918259
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#767574 is the less saturated color, while #e2a808 is the most saturated one.
